About Fabio Cuttica

Fabio Cuttica is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ality and Biomaterials, having authored 26 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Flame retardant materials and properties (26 papers), Fire dynamics and safety research (8 papers) and Polymer Nanocomposites and Properties (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(1.3k citations),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ality (338 citations) and Biomaterials (371 citations). Fabio Cuttica has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Sweden and France. Frequent co-authors include Federico Carosio, Jenny Alongi, Giulio Malucelli, Alessandro Di Blasio, Francesca Bosco, Riccardo Andrea Carletto, Lars A. Berglund, Alberto Fina, Alberto Frache and Giovanni Camino. Their work appears in journals such as 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ces, Carbohydrate Polymers and Industrial & Engineering Chemistry Research.
